 /**
  * Create a builder which makes creates the SecureRandom objects from a specified entropy source provider.
  * <p>
  * <b>Note:</b> If this constructor is used any calls to setSeed() in the resulting SecureRandom will be ignored.
  * </p>
  * @param entropySourceProvider a provider of EntropySource objects.
  */
 public X931SecureRandomBuilder(IEntropySourceProvider entropySourceProvider)
 {
     this.mRandom = null;
     this.mEntropySourceProvider = entropySourceProvider;
 }

 /**
  * Construct a builder with an EntropySourceProvider based on the passed in SecureRandom and the passed in value
  * for prediction resistance.
  * <p>
  * Any SecureRandom created from a builder constructed like this will make use of input passed to SecureRandom.setSeed() if
  * the passed in SecureRandom does for its generateSeed() call.
  * </p>
  * @param entropySource
  * @param predictionResistant
  */
 public X931SecureRandomBuilder(SecureRandom entropySource, bool predictionResistant)
 {
     this.mRandom = entropySource;
     this.mEntropySourceProvider = new BasicEntropySourceProvider(mRandom, predictionResistant);
 }
